Silent Curtain for Patrick Adiarte

Patrick Adiarte’s story is described as one of quiet strength and persistence. He is portrayed as someone who “moved through history like a ghost in plain sight,” a Filipino boy shaped by war who entered American entertainment spaces that were rarely open to people like him.

On screen, his presence carried meaning beyond performance. Rather than forcing change loudly, he represented a subtle form of resistance, simply by existing in spaces where he was not expected. The article describes him as someone who did not “break through the door so much as stand inside it,” showing that belonging can sometimes be an act of quiet defiance.

As his acting opportunities faded, he did not chase fame or public attention. Instead, he shifted toward teaching and mentorship. In studios and classrooms, he focused on guiding others, offering structure, discipline, and support that he himself had often lacked in the industry.

His work as a teacher became a different kind of legacy. He gave students not just training but a sense of being seen and valued. While many may not fully realize the significance of his journey, his influence continues through those he taught and inspired.

In the end, the article suggests that even if his name becomes less widely remembered, his impact remains. His life reflects a quieter form of success—one built not on lasting fame, but on shaping others and leaving behind meaningful change.
